Installation

Unpack and inspect contents. Place on a stable surface and ensure proper leveling.

  1. Connect water supply: Attach hoses to hot and cold water valves.
  2. Plug into AC power: Ensure outlet is grounded.
  3. Check for leaks: Run a test cycle to ensure all connections are secure.

WARNING! Ensure washer is level to avoid vibrations during operation.

Connecting Water Supply

Ensure proper connection to hot and cold water supply lines.

  1. Turn off water supply before connecting hoses.
  2. Match hoses to corresponding water inlet valves.
  3. Check for leaks after connections are made.

Tip: Use Teflon tape on threads to prevent leaks.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Washer won't startPower supply issueCheck power cord and outlet.
Water not fillingHose kinkedEnsure hoses are straight and connected.
Clothes not cleaningOverloadingReduce load size and try again.
Unusual noiseForeign objectCheck drum for items and remove.

Reset: Unplug for 5 minutes to reset the control board.
